Genetic portrait of the Punjabi population from Pakistan using the Precision ID Ancestry Panel.

Prediction of geographical ancestry using genetic markers has a great potential in forensic genetics and may be used as an investigative lead in crime casework or missing person identification. Exploration of AIMs in Pakistan is interesting due to the distinct subpopulations with multidirectional ancestry from different groups. In the current study, 87 individuals from the Punjabi population from Pakistan were investigated using the Precision ID Ancestry Panel (Thermo Fisher Scientific) to assess whether it was possible to diff ;erentiate Punjabi individuals from other populations. With this panel, it is revealed that Punjabis are admixed and cannot be distinguished from other populations in South Central Asia and the Middle East.
